Dhaneri Census 2011: Key Statistics and Insights

As per the 2011 Census, Dhaneri Village has a population of 638 (638) with 322 (322) males and 316 (316) females.The sex ratio in Dhaneri is 982, indicating an above-average ratio compared to the national average of 943 .

Child Population (Age group 0-6 years) of Dhaneri Village is 116 (116) which is 18.18% of Dhaneri Village overall population, Child sex Ratio of Dhaneri Village is 1072 females for every 1000 males.

Note : In the 2011 Census, Dhaneri village is listed as part of the Asind Subdistrict (Tahsil) of the Bhilwara District in the state of RAJASTHAN in INDIA.

Dhaneri Literacy Rate

Dhaneri Village has a literacy rate of 86.78% which is higher than national average of 72.98%, The Male literacy rate of Dhaneri Village is 92.11 higher than national average of 80.88%, The Female literacy rate of Dhaneri Village is 81.25 higher than national average of 64.63%.

Dhaneri Area & Households

The Total Number of households in Dhaneri Village are 131 (131).

Dhaneri Workforce (Worker Profile) Overview

In Dhaneri Village, there are about 340 (340) workers, making up nearly 53.29% of the Dhaneri Village total population. Out of these, around 169 (169) are male workers, and about 171 (171) are female workers.
